What Exactly Is a Loft Style Apartment?

Apartments come in many varieties. Among these, the so-called ‘Loft Apartment’ usually features higher ceilings, and larger windows, and frequently includes industrial design elements.

Crouse, NC Local Guide

Largest Available Crouse and Nearby 2 Bedroom Apartments

The largest available 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Crouse, NC is found at River Rock at Dallas in the Sundance Village neighborhood and is 1,354 square feet priced from $1,999. Loray Mill Lofts in the East Park neighborhood has the second largest 2 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,275 square feet and currently listed start at $1,705. Cheapest Available Crouse and Nearby 2 Bedroom Apartments

As of March 15, 2025 the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Crouse, NC is the 2 BR, 1.5BA Model starting from $842 at Central School Lofts . The second most affordable Crouse 2 Bedroom is the Two Bedroom Model at Caitlin Station starting at $927 . The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Crouse is currently $1,626. Quick Rent Budget Calculator

How much rent can you afford?

The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
